Output 8689a3868be36f25eb6199fa9e1d4d70da274b4ec5c34e120b4b50d22f1232a5:0

value
4350002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 740029278a1733c2fe54ea13e444d108863a8b23 OP_EQUAL
address
3CGNVxyPG9iWGMkE4JQJz18Kch6xiLPVQh
transaction
8689a3868be36f25eb6199fa9e1d4d70da274b4ec5c34e120b4b50d22f1232a5
spent
true